CVE-2026-33524
HIGHZserio: Integer Overflow in BitStreamReader and Unbounded Memory Allocation in Deserialization
Title source: cnaDescription
Zserio is a framework for serializing structured data with a compact and efficient way with low overhead. Prior to 2.18.1, a crafted payload as small as 4-5 bytes can force memory allocations of up to 16 GB, crashing any process with an OOM error (Denial of Service). This vulnerability is fixed in 2.18.1.
